Quick Summary
The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Land and Maritime is seeking quotes for Cartridge Fuses (NSN 5920006360963). This is a Combined Synopsis/Solicitation (RFQ) for a Qualified Products List (QPL) item. The solicitation may result in an Automated Indefinite Delivery Contract (IDC). Quotes are due March 18, 2026.
Scope of Work
This proposed procurement is for 490 units of Cartridge Fuses (NSN 5920006360963). Delivery is required within 160 days after order (ADO). Items will be shipped to various CONUS and OCONUS DLA Depots. This is a Qualified Products List (QPL) item, meaning only products from approved manufacturers will be considered.
Contract & Timeline
- Type: Combined Synopsis/Solicitation (RFQ) leading to an Automated Indefinite Delivery Contract (IDC)
- Contract Term: One year or until aggregate total orders reach $350,000.00
- Estimated Orders: 11 per year
- Guaranteed Minimum: 73 units
- Set-Aside: None specified
- Quote Due: March 18, 2026
- Published: March 3, 2026
- Agency: DLA Land and Maritime, DEPT OF DEFENSE
Submission & Additional Notes
This solicitation is an RFQ and will be available electronically via the link provided in the notice. Hard copies are not available. Military Specifications and Standards can be retrieved electronically. All responsible sources may submit a quote, which will be considered if timely received. Quotes must be submitted electronically. Questions should be emailed to the buyer listed in block 5 of the solicitation document, or to DibbsBSM@dla.mil if the link is unavailable.
